Umbilical Cord
A flexible cord-like structure containing blood vessels that connect a fetus to the placenta, supplying it with oxygen and nutrients during pregnancy.
Placenta
An organ that develops in the uterus during pregnancy, providing oxygen and nutrients to and removing waste from the fetus through the umbilical cord.
Oxygenated Blood
Blood that is rich in oxygen, typically found in the arterial system, except for the pulmonary arteries, which carry deoxygenated blood to the lungs.
Arteries
Blood vessels that carry oxygen-rich blood away from the heart to all parts of the body.
